Capito optimistic about state getting ‘hydrogen hub’
May 26, 2022
The possibility of West Virginia being the site for a “hydrogen hub” still looms large.
Sen. Shelley Moore Capito, R-W.Va., said last week during a virtual press conference it is a “very exciting project.”
The project, also touted by Sen. Joe Manchin, D-W.Va., and Gov. Jim Justice, was announced earlier this year as the WV Hydrogen Hub Working Group was formed “to collaborate and support a strong West Virginia candidate to be chosen to develop a hydrogen hub.”
